Joined by an assortment of New York's finest, 29-year-old star guitarist Jesse Van Ruller, Holland's first Thelonious Monk Competition Award-winner, emphatically stamps his voice on a meaty program of jazz originals, less-traveled songbook gems, and an original blues.
On piano the great David Hazeltine, with bassists Nat Reeves or Frans Van Geest, and Joe Farnsworth or Willie Jones III on drums.
